Our good old friend Keith from the small tech shop we bought out told us this Panasonic Toughbook laptop was indestructible. We don’t think so much. But just how much damage can it take? What ARE the standards for deeming a computer as “rugged”? Was Keith overselling it or does this PC have an adamantium chassis and the ability to regenerate?
